Engineering capabilities
Steady-State Studies
Load flow and reactive studies confirming utility and plant design requirements.
Protection Coordination
Relay coordination and settings aligned with NERC PRC standards including PRC-019, PRC-023, PRC-025, and PRC-029.
NERC GO Package
Support for NERC FAC, PRC, CIP, VAR, IRO, EOP, BAL, MOD, and annual maintenance requirements.
EMT Studies
TOV/TRV, transformer energization, black-start, and other high-fidelity EMT studies.
Arc Flash Studies
Arc flash calculations and labels for safe plant operations.
Harmonic & Flicker
Harmonic and flicker performance assessment against IEEE 519 and IEEE 2800.
Local Studies
Grounding, cable ampacity, and electromagnetic interference studies.

Full study package through successful COD
Union Ridge Solar
INS provided a full study package for the 100 MW Union Ridge Solar project in AEP Ohio, covering grounding, cable ampacity, load flow, harmonic, EMT, protection, and arc flash studies. The project achieved commercial operation successfully at the end of December 2025.
